Jquery AJAX HTML是一種常用的技術(shù),它可以幫助我們實(shí)現(xiàn)異步請(qǐng)求和響應(yīng),從而達(dá)到和服務(wù)器交互的目的。下面是一個(gè)簡(jiǎn)單的例子:
$.ajax({ url: "ajax/test.html", success: function(result){ $("p").html(result); } });
在這個(gè)例子中,我們首先使用$.ajax()方法來(lái)發(fā)送異步請(qǐng)求。我們指定了請(qǐng)求的URL,即ajax/test.html。當(dāng)服務(wù)器返回響應(yīng)時(shí),我們使用success回調(diào)函數(shù)來(lái)處理響應(yīng)。在這個(gè)回調(diào)函數(shù)中,我們將返回的HTML內(nèi)容插入到頁(yè)面中的所有<p>元素中。
除了使用success回調(diào)函數(shù)之外,我們還可以使用其他一些回調(diào)函數(shù)來(lái)處理Ajax請(qǐng)求。例如,如果想在請(qǐng)求過(guò)程中顯示一個(gè)加載圖標(biāo),可以使用beforeSend回調(diào)函數(shù);如果請(qǐng)求失敗,可以使用error回調(diào)函數(shù)。以下是一個(gè)完整的例子:
$.ajax({ url: "ajax/test.html", beforeSend: function() { $("#loading").show(); }, success: function(data) { $("#result").html(data); }, error: function() { $("#result").html("An error occurred."); }, complete: function() { $("#loading").hide(); } });
在這個(gè)例子中,我們使用了beforeSend回調(diào)函數(shù)來(lái)顯示一個(gè)加載圖標(biāo)。當(dāng)請(qǐng)求成功時(shí),我們使用success回調(diào)函數(shù)來(lái)將返回的HTML內(nèi)容插入到頁(yè)面中的一個(gè)特定的元素中。如果請(qǐng)求失敗,我們使用error回調(diào)函數(shù)來(lái)顯示一個(gè)錯(cuò)誤消息。最后,我們使用complete回調(diào)函數(shù)來(lái)隱藏加載圖標(biāo)。
總的來(lái)說(shuō),Jquery AJAX HTML提供了一種強(qiáng)大的工具,在Web開(kāi)發(fā)中經(jīng)常被使用。如果我們想獲得更多的信息,可以查看Jquery文檔或其他相關(guān)的資源。